Feruza Egamova covers Ajda Pekkan’s “Arada Sirada”

tops3 125px-Flag_of_Uzbekistan.svg 125px-Flag_of_Turkey.svgAnother epic Turkish song echoing in Uzbekistan is "Arada Sirada", Ajda Pekkan's 2011 smash hit. Feruza Egamova's "Ishq fasli" gives some minor changes to the dance version of Ajda's version and translates the song to the Uzbek language. While it's an ok song, it's bleak compared to the original. One does not mess with divas...

Change of tune

 

As their latest single Belanova changed their song and dished us something different, after 7 years of electro pop that seemed to become repetitive after their second album. This melodramatic tearjerker has a video that fits. It's their 2011 version of traditional Mexican music. Even if it's not my cup of tea, I have to applaud them for mixing it up, and give us something new. The video is a great production and tell a "moving" story.
